1. Your Business Needs

The first and foremost thing to consider is your business needs. As a business owner, you know the specific requirements of your industry and the type of vehicle that will best suit your needs. Whether you are in the construction industry or deliver goods, you need to consider the type of cargo or equipment you will be transporting, the terrain you will be driving on, and the distance you will be covering on a daily or weekly basis.

These factors will help you determine the appropriate size, power, and features of the GMC Denali that will best fit your business needs. Once you have a clear understanding of what your business requires, you can confidently narrow down your options and make the right choice.

2. Budget

As a business owner, it is crucial to have a budget in mind when purchasing a commercial vehicle. The GMC Denali is a high-end and luxurious commercial vehicle, and with that comes a higher price tag. However, it is essential to determine how much you are willing to spend and stick to that budget.

Do your research and compare prices from different dealerships to ensure you are getting the best deal. You can also consider buying a used GMC Denali, as it can help you save a significant amount of money. But always remember, the price should not be the only factor when making your decision. The vehicle’s reliability, performance, and features should also be taken into consideration.

3. Vehicle Specifications

The GMC Denali is a versatile vehicle that comes in different sizes and models. You need to choose the perfect model that will meet your business needs. Are you looking for a cargo van or a pickup truck? Do you need a vehicle with four-wheel-drive capabilities? These are some of the crucial specifications to consider before making your purchase.

You should also look into the engine size and power, fuel efficiency, towing and payload capacities, and safety features. Opt for the specific GMC Denali model that matches your business needs and enables you to operate smoothly and efficiently.

4. Maintenance and Insurance Costs

Before buying a GMC Denali, it is essential to understand the maintenance and insurance costs associated with it. As a business owner, you need to factor in these costs into your budget. The maintenance cost will depend on the vehicle’s model, age, and mileage, while the insurance cost will be determined by your business location, driving record, and the type of coverage you choose.

It is crucial to maintain your GMC Denali regularly to ensure its performance and prolong its lifespan. Regular maintenance can also help you avoid costly repairs in the future. As for insurance, shop around for the best deals and choose the coverage that will protect your vehicle and business adequately.

5. Test Drive and Inspection

Once you have narrowed down your options, it is time to take a test drive and inspect the vehicle. A test drive will help you get a feel for the vehicle’s performance, handling, and comfort. It is also an opportunity to get familiar with the vehicle’s features and see if it meets your specific requirements.

During the inspection, make sure to check the vehicle’s exterior and interior for any damages or defects. Also, ask for the vehicle’s service records to ensure it has been well-maintained. If possible, take a trusted mechanic with you to thoroughly inspect the vehicle and provide you with an expert opinion.
